The National Building Research Organisation (NBRO) has urged the public to stay alert for early warnings about landslides. According to the NBRO, the Department of Meteorology has predicted rain in several areas of Sri Lanka, including the Northern, North Central, Eastern, Uva, and Central Provinces, starting today (29). The NBRO specifically advises people living in hilly regions and near riverbanks to take extra care. Residents of areas that have been inspected and marked as at risk for landslides should follow previous safety instructions closely. The NBRO also asked those living in hilly places, areas prone to rockfalls, and regions at risk for landslides to be watchful for dangerous conditions. The public is encouraged to heed the latest landslide early warnings from the NBRO. Furthermore, places that already show early signs of landslides could become active with even light rain. Therefore, the NBRO advises residents in these areas to evacuate to safer locations if they notice increasing rainfall.
